Miami Heat superstar Jimmy Butler knows the Milwaukee Bucks will focus their tactics on stopping him in the playoff series.

Butler doesn’t care about what happened in the 2020 playoffs, and is locked in ahead of the clash with the Bucks.

“I guarantee that they still got a scout for me, whether I played or not. I’m ready for anything. You leave the past in the past, all the wins, all the losses, all the mishaps, all the great fortunes.

It’s a different time of the year right now. You’re supposed to be playing your best basketball, be healthy. And first one to 16 wins, so we’ve got start with the first four,” Butler said of the Bucks, via Ira Winderman of Sun Sentinel.

Butler and the Heat will open the playoffs series vs Milwaukee on Saturday afternoon.
